INTRODUCTION
1.1 BACKGROUND OF THE STUDY:
The major issue here is the impact of training and development on workers productivity.
According to Chukwuemeka (2015:3,7), in his first published text other functions of management (incisive approach) the most valuable assets of any organizations are employees. Hey can as well called human resources. Employees are the people who work for the organization. For employees better performance, the management organize a programme which is training and development as the method for enhancing the employees skills, increasing the individual and organizational performance, improving the employee morale and achieving the business growth and success. This programme improves employees knowledge, skills and ability all this acquire enable them to be more competence and effective with their job and this leads to an increase in their productivity.
This research work is aimed at finding out the impact of training and development towards workers performance and productivity with particular reference to lemon Nigeria Plc. In summary, training and development of workers are factors that influence productivity, effectiveness and performance in organization.
